Letcher 10-Codes (KSP) 10-Codes/Signals 20070318

10-CODES

  • 10-1 Receiving Poorly
  • 10-2 Receiving Well
  • 10-3 Radio Silence Unless Emergency(s)
  • 10-4 O.K.
  • 10-5 Relay
  • 10-6 Busy
  • 10-7 Out of service (or Deceased)
  • 10-8 In service
  • 10-9 Repeat Your Traffic
  • 10-10 Out of service-subject to call
  • 10-11 Talking too Fast
  • 10-12 Person(s) Present with Unit
  • 10-12A (10-12 Alert)-Emergency/ Confidential INFO/ASAP
  • 10-13 Wx Conditions
  • 10-14 Convoy or Escort
  • 10-15 Prisoner, Prisoner in Custody
  • 10-16 Pick up prisoners at:
  • 10-20 Location
  • 10-21 Call by telephone
  • 10-25 (Do You Have) Contact With
  • 10-29 Check for Wanted/Stolen
  • 10-29C Criminal History
  • 10-29E Epic Inquiry
  • 10-29L Check for Local Warrants/Paperwork
  • 10-30 Radio TRF Does Not Conform to Policy
  • 10-31 Domestic Violence/Crime at_____
  • 10-33 School Violence/Crime at ____
  • 10-34 School Visit
  • 10-35 Confidential
  • 10-36 Correct time
  • 10-37 Dispatcher
  • 10-44 Traffic Stop
  • 10-45 Non-injury Accident
  • 10-46 Injury Accident
  • 10-47 Vehicle Registration (w/o VIN)
  • 10-49 Payroll Checks
  • 10-50 Expense Checks
  • 10-51 Wrecker
  • 10-52 Ambulance/EMS
  • 10-53 Request Back-up
  • 10-54 Request Coroner
  • 10-60 Suspicious Person
  • 10-61 Motorist Assist
  • 10-62 Loud Party
  • 10-64 Status Check "Are You O.K.?"
  • 10-65 I Am O.K.(Reply to 10-64, 10-4 or any other response means Trooper is Not O.K.)
  • 10-74 Suicidal Person
  • 10-75 Bomb Threat
  • 10-80 Corpse
  • 10-85 Wanted Person
  • 10-86 Wanted Person-Felony
  • 10-88 Telephone number
  • 10-90 Alarm
  • 10-92 Officer Hostage Situation
  • 10-95 What is Your ETA?
  • 10-96 En Route
  • 10-98 Finished last assignment

Signals

  • 1 Officer's Home/Officer is at Home
  • 2 Meet at______
  • 3 Traffic or Messages
  • 4 Post
  • 5 Eating
  • 6 Call Telephone Number
  • 7 Emergency - Officer Down Situation
  • 8 Disregard
  • 9 Rush - Emergency Action Desired
  • 10 Confidential Information
  • 11 Communicable Disease Hazard/Universal Precautions Apply

Other Codes

  • 0100 Speeding
  • 0115 Reckless Driving
  • 0148 DUI--Drugs
  • 0149 Drunk driving
  • 202A Involuntary Hospitalization
  • 600 Mental Patient/"Acting Mental"
  • 2301 Public Intoxication
  • 2304 Under the Influence of Drugs Abbreviations
  • UTL Unable to Locate
  • ATL Attempt to locate
  • MVA Motor Vehicle Accident
  • MVC Motor Vehicle Collision
  • GSW Gun Shot Wound
